Tarmac
Classic black asphalt — clean, fast, ready to quote.
Tarmac is the workhorse: long drives, shared accesses, farm tracks and rural lanes. The widget renders fresh-laid asphalt with edge kerbs and white-lined options so commercial customers can pre-approve the spec before site visit.


Tap sides · Pinch to zoom
Best for
When to quote tarmac.
- Long rural driveways and shared accesses
- Commercial yards and car parks
- Customers prioritising cost-per-m²
